    As an individual who loves food, I have to say I genuinely appreciate the food quality and authenticity at saffron. The highest praise I can give to an establishment that serves Indian food, is to say it reminds me of my grandmother and how she cooked for my family. To which, the food and staff really do.The menu is continuously rotating dishes so that a selection can be made fresh, daily. The ownership and staff are all family. This makes a huge difference to food quality, it clearly shows. I have been to several places in Calgary; however, hands down, their aloo ghobi and vindaloo’s are the best I could find, to my taste. Other more pricey restaurants don’t take as much time to make their own masala or seek out fresh spices. You can taste these differences. I no longer make my favorite dishes at home (often). Instead I differ to their experience. I know they put the same care in as I would have. In terms of food quality for the money, the other Indian takeout within a huge radius can’t compete. By far, the most value. Try Saffron once like I did and you’ll regret not having gone sooner.
